What percentage of americans claim a religious affiliation?

Approximately some 75% of people in the United States claim to be religious, with some ~70% of the population claiming to be Christian while ~6% claim to be of a different religion. Around a quarter of the population states that they are not religious or are atheists or even something else.

The sound device in which vowel sounds of nearby words are repeated is called

Assonance is the sound device in which vowel sounds of nearby words are repeated. These are usually found in prose and poetry, with the purpose of setting the mood.

Ex. "Hear the mellow wedding bells" in the poem The Bells by Edgar Allan Poe. In this line, the mood was set by using vowel "e" as literary device.

What disturbing quality does heathcliff exhibit in relation to his feelings for hindley?

First of all, Heatchliff does not have feelings <em>for </em>Hindley, he rather has feelings against Hindley and very strong and negative ones at that. Psychologically speaking, Heathcliff shows a very vengeful sadism against Hindley as he comes back a well off man who manipulates Hindley's gambling and drinking addictions in order to financially ruin him and have him mortgage Wuthering Heights to Heathclif in order to pay off his gambling and drinking debts. This will result in HIndley's death later in the story.
